Annotations of Ll_transcript_170103
Blastp | Meiotic recombination protein DMC1 homolog from Soja with 94.78% of identity |
---|---|
Blastx | Meiotic recombination protein DMC1 homolog from Soja with 94.78% of identity |
Eggnog | Can catalyze the hydrolysis of ATP in the presence of single-stranded DNA, the ATP-dependent uptake of single-stranded DNA by duplex DNA, and the ATP-dependent hybridization of homologous single-stranded DNAs. It interacts with LexA causing its activation and leading to its autocatalytic cleavage (By similarity)(COG0468) |
